PROJECT FINANCING
150 affordable housing units
2 – 530 square foot studio apartments. Rent = $1,475
122 – 720 square foot one bedroom apartments. Rent = $1,581
24 – 1,028 square foot two bedroom apartments. Rent = $1,895
2 – 1,150 square foot three bedroom apartments. Rent = $2,159
Sources:First Mortgage 25,450,000 CRA Loans / Grants 5,000,000 Deferred Developer Fee 2,050,000 Equity 14,959,518
47,459,518
Uses:Capitalized lease payment 350,000 Construction & Sitework 37,150,000 Construction Period Interest 473,461 Professional Fees 2,229,163 Marketing and Leasing 202,500 Lender Fees 1,004,095 Developer Fees 4,150,000 Interest Costs 1,900,299
47,459,518
LEASE TERMS
Proposal of a 99-year land lease with the County so the development qualifies for FHA HUD financingUpfront capitalized lease payment of $350,000Annual lease with County = $100,000 per year + 50% of project cash flow.
Year 1 estimated total $120,144Year 2 estimated total $135,185Year 3 estimated total $170,427Year 4 estimated total $195,866Year 5 estimated total $201,509

OUR VISION DELIVERS
150 affordable housing units to households earning up to 120% of Area Median Income,
Building density that fits with the neighborhood,
Unit sizes that are truly livable and provide ample space for a variety live/work arrangements,
20 additional commuter park and ride spaces located on the proposed Wave light rail line,
2,195 sq. ft. of retail/commercial spaces for community- based businesses,
Community relevant design bridging the Flager Arts and Technology District and the Sistrunk Planning Corridor,
Sustainable building built to the Florida Green Building Code, and
Local hiring, project participation and marketing driven by Fort Lauderdale Community Center.

BUILDING FEATURES/AMENITIES
150 housing units: 2 studio, 122 one-bedroom, 24 two-bedroom, and 2 three-bedroom units (can modify unit mix through market study/County goals),Larger unit sizes that can accommodate a variety of live/work arrangements,170 parking spaces, including 20 park and ride spaces with separate designated entrance/exit,Sustainable project Florida Green Building Code and will feature a green roof, low flow water fixtures, energy star appliances and high efficiency mechanical systems,Transit oriented development on proposed Wave light rail line, 12 bicycle parking spaces, 20 park and ride spacesUnique urban design and welcoming streetscape including tenant amenities and ground floor commercial space to enliven streetscape at 6th and Andrews AvenuesUpscale building amenities including swimming pool, landscaped roof terrace and fitness center
PROJECT HIGHLIGHTS – UNIT SIZE/DENSITY
Our design features larger units than other proposers.
Typical one bedroom unit approximately 700 square feet of living space.
Typical two bedroom unit approximately 1,000 square feet.
Larger unit sizes can accommodate a variety of live/work arrangements.
Building massing designed to complement more dense development on Andrews Avenue while not overwhelming existing smaller scale development east of site.

PROJECT HIGHLIGHTS – SUSTAINABILITY
Utilizing the Florida Green Building Code - a holistic approach to sustainability including building materials, construction practices, disaster mitigation, land use and sustainable building features
Each housing and commercial unit and all common spaces will feature Energy Star Appliances, low flow water fixtures and energy efficient lighting,
Building features a green roof and high efficiency mechanical systems
Team has extensive experience in sustainability – current project Wisdom Village Fort Lauderdale (615 N. Andrews Avenue) utilizing Florida Green Building Code
Our project truly maximizing sustainability features while keeping costs low
PROJECT HIGHLIGHTS – COMMUNITY COMMITTMENT
Proven commitment to local hiring and promotion of local businesses.
Building on our successful local hiring and business program at 615 N. Andrews where local utilization is 30%.
We commit to ensuring at least 25% of project costs are committed to local businesses and local hiring.
Fort Lauderdale Community Center – a pillar in the Fort Lauderdale Community – will lead our diversity, local utilization and marketing efforts.
Through our strategic partnership with Fort Lauderdale Community Center, we commit to hire woman, minority and veteran owned businesses (W/M/DBE).
